comparemela.com

Top Locations Tagged with Spoty Shop

Spoty Shop in India - 680012/Pet-store near thrissur/Pet-store near Thrissur

1). Spoty Wolf Pet Shop, Irimbranallur, Kerala

vimarsana © 2020. All Rights Reserved.